+ Responder ao Tópico



  1. #1
    chvt
    Visitante

    Padrão openssh

    Eu uso o Slackware 9.1 e atualizei o meu openssh 3.7.1p2 para o 3.8 e agora o sshd está iniciando no boot, já tentei no rc.sshd para que o mesmo não inicie no boot e não consegui. Alguém sabe o que eu posso fazer para o sshd não iniciar no boot :?:

  2. #2
    slice
    Visitante

    Padrão sshd

    o interessante é que ele sempre inicie no boot, se vc precisar acessar a máquina remotamente, basta pedir para qualquer pessoa ligar a maquina e ta tudo ok.

    mas se vc não quiser este serviço ativo, faça o seguinte:

    comente as linhas que chamam o /etc/rc.d/rc.sshd no arquivo /etc/rc.d/rc.M

    Boa sorte!



  3. #3
    chvt
    Visitante

    Padrão openssh

    slice,

    Não tem nada sobre sshd no diretório: /etc/rc.d/rc.M e eu já tentei fazer algo no diretório: /etc/rc.d/rc.sshd mas mesmo assim o sshd está iniciando no boot.

  4. #4
    slice
    Visitante

    Padrão sshd

    ok!

    é que eu estava no trampo e não dava pra confirmar com certeza

    vamos lá...

    no arquivo /etc/rc.d/rc.inetd2 procure pela chamada do sshd e comente-as, provavelmente as linhas 80 a 83.
    a chamada que starta o sshd no boot é a seguinte:

    # Start the OpenSSH SSH daemon:
    if [ -x /etc/rc.d/rc.sshd ]; then
    echo "Starting OpenSSH SSH daemon: /usr/sbin/sshd"
    /etc/rc.d/rc.sshd start
    fi

    se vc estiver com a instalação default, é aí mesmo, caso contrário, entre no diretorio /etc/rc.d e de o comando grep rc.sshd ai basta analizar em qual arquivo esta esta chamada, no meu deu este resultado:

    [email protected]:/etc/rc.d# grep rc.sshd start *
    grep: start: No such file or directory
    rc.inet2:if [ -x /etc/rc.d/rc.sshd ]; then
    rc.inet2: /etc/rc.d/rc.sshd start

    e na pior das ipóteses (acho que não vai precisar) tire a permissão de execução do /etc/rc.d/rc.sshd com o comando chmod -x /etc/rc.d/rc.sshd


    qualquer coisa grita de novo

    []'s



  5. #5
    chvt
    Visitante

    Padrão openssh

    Valeu pela ajuda slice, consegui resolver com o: chmod -x /etc/rc.d/rc.sshd

  6. #6
    slice
    Visitante

    Padrão ssh

    que bom!

    lembre-se que qdo vc quiser startar o sshd de novo, vc vai ter que dar permissão a ele novamente chmod +x /etc/rc.d/rc.sshd

    []'s

    slice